E-book reader
About this app
Open source e-book reader for Android.
Supported e-book formats through the use of the crengine-ng library: fb2, fb3 (incomplete), epub (non-DRM), doc, docx, odt, rtf, pdb, mobi (non-DRM), txt, html, Markdown, chm, tcr.
Main features:
• Most complete support for FB2 - styles, tables, footnotes at the bottom of the page
• Extensive font rendering capabilities: use of ligatures, kerning, hinting option selection, floating punctuation, simultaneous use of several fonts, including fallback fonts
• Word hyphenation using hyphenation dictionaries
• Ability to display 2 pages at the same time
• Displaying and Navigating Book Contents
• Ability to use bookmarks
• Reading books directly from a ZIP archive
• TXT auto reformat, automatic encoding recognition
• Flexible styling with CSS files
• Background pictures, textures, or solid background
• Animation of turning pages - like in a paper book or simple shift
• Customizable actions for touch screen zones
• View illustrations with scrolling and zooming - by long pressing on the illustration
• Select text and send it either to the clipboard or to another application, etc.
• Reading aloud with the possibility of using accent dictionary
• Built-in book library with search and/or filtering
• Simple built-in file manager for viewing the list of files on the device
Licensed under GPL-3.0-or-later, by Aleksey Chernov.

How to verify the file you downloaded
Before you install anything, confirm the file is the one described here. On a computer, run shasum -a 256 your-download.apk (macOS or Linux) or certutil -hashfile your-download.apk SHA256 (Windows), then compare the output character-for-character with the SHA-256 on this page. If a single character differs, the file is not the build we recorded — delete it.
What the signing certificate proves
Every Android app is signed with a private key that only its developer holds. The fingerprint on this page is a hash of the matching public certificate, and it proves continuity rather than identity: it tells you a build came from whoever signed the earlier ones. Android enforces this at install time — if a package claiming to be io.gitlab.coolreader_ng.lxreader.fdroid is signed with a different key, the system will refuse to install it over your existing copy. A fingerprint that changes between releases is worth pausing on, because a repackaged app that has been modified by someone else cannot keep the original signature.
How to roll back to an earlier version
If the current release misbehaves, 0.8.5 (fdroid) is the last build before it. Android will not install an older version code over a newer one, so you must uninstall LxReader first — which clears its local data unless you have a backup. Reinstall the older APK only if its signing fingerprint matches the build you already trust, and check the API range: an older release may target an Android version your device has moved past.
